Step-By-Step Conversion Process
Start by writing down 29 as the number of centimeters you want to convert. Then recall that one inch equals 2.54 centimeters. To find the equivalent in inches divide the centimeter amount by 2.54.
- Set up the division: 29 ÷ 2.54
- Calculate the quotient using a calculator or long division method
- Round the result to two decimal places if needed for practical use
Doing the math yields approximately 11.42 inches. This means that 29 cm spans just under 11 and a half inches, which fits neatly between common standard sizes like 11 inches and 12 inches.
If you prefer an approximate rule of thumb, 2.5 cm roughly equals 1 inch. Multiply 29 by 0.4 to get a quick estimate, then adjust if precision is required. The exact figure keeps your work safe from rounding errors that could affect patterns or fittings.

Quick Reference Table for Common Conversions
Below is a table linking popular centimeter measurements to their inch equivalents. It serves as a handy reference when you need speed rather than repeated calculations.
| Centimeters (cm) | Inches (in) |
|---|---|
| 25 | 9.84 |
| 30 | 11.81 |
| 35 | 13.78 |
| 40 | 15.75 |
| 45 | 17.72 |
